CSPE Education Foundation
 
 

The California Society of Professional Engineers Education Foundation (CSPEEF) was incorporated in 1986 to provide a commitment to the development of a more educated and aware populace.  The Foundation’s charge is to provide the resources designed to increase the mathematical, engineering, scientific, and technical capabilities of California students.  It does this through three main programs:

 

bullet

MATHCOUNTS in California

bullet

Ingersoll FE/EIT Grant Program

bullet

Construction and Career Technical Education (CTE) - through an alliance with the California Coalition for Construction in the Classroom

 

CSPEEF is completely volunteer-driven.  Every year, due to the generosity of caring individuals and companies, CSPEEF is able to sponsor MATHCOUNTS in 25 local communities and State Competitions at UC Davis and UC Irvine, as well as provide countless Ingersoll Grants and advocate construction and career education.
